Physical therapy?

I hurt my shoulder three weeks and am going to physical therapy in three days. I want to get a headstart however, and would like some exercises to do at home. I'm not really sure what exactly is wrong with my shoulder for a trainer has said it is a sublaxemation, one doctor says it is a contusion and yet another says it was a torn muscle. Please help! = D


Answers:

There is no exercise that we can recommend you do without first performing an evaluation. Physical therapy is highly individualized and completely dependent on the results of your physical exam. For instance, a diagnosis of "subluxation" is meaningless for rehab until we find out in what direction the joint in lax, which specific muscles are weak or tight...etc. Starting three days earlier should not have any affect on your outcomes. I would wait until the PT exam. Good luck.
